Ingredients

Quantities are shown as originally provided.

  • 1 orange (juiced; makes ½ orange juice)
  • 1 lemon (juiced; makes ¼ lemon juice)
  • ¼ cup olive
  • 1 tablespoon (honey; substitute with maple syrup)
  • 1 – 2 cloves of garlic (grated; optional)
  • ½ teaspoon salt (always add salt according to your taste or doctor’s order)
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on ground turmeric (optional)
  • 1 tablespoon of orange zest (optional)

Instructions

  1. 1

    Zest the orange.

  2. 2

    Squeeze the juice out of lemon and orange using a squeezer.

  3. 3

    In a mason jar, add all the ingredients: salt, pepper, turmeric, honey, freshly squeezed orange juice, lemon juice, grate in the garlic, and olive oil. Then cover the mason jar, and give it a very good shake. Taste and adjust appropriately, enjoy!
